Altuve supplied the only runs of the game in Sunday’s pitchers duel between Jameson Taillon and Framber Valdez, taking Taillon deep for a two-run shot in the fifth inning. The 35-year-old second baseman is up to 13 homers while slashing .260/.319/.418 with 39 runs scored, 36 RBI, and six steals across 342 plate appearances.

Hader was summoned in the ninth to close out the game and complete the shutout of the Cubs with a two-run lead. He struck out one batter in a perfect inning to convert his 23rd save of the season. Hader holds a sparkling 1.67 ERA over 37 2/3 innings.

After the Mariners scored a pair of runs in the top half of the 10th inning, Seager answered back with a 395-foot (106.2 mph EV) two-run blast off of Carlos Vargas that knotted things up at three runs apiece. That would wind up being his only hit in four at-bats on the afternoon, though he also worked a walk. The 31-year-old shortstop is now hitting .244/.342/.430 with 10 homers, 22 RBI and one stolen base through his first 52 games on the season.

Trevor Megill had recorded the first two outs in the ninth inning without issue as Arcia strolled to the dish representing the Rockies’ final hope while trailing by one run. After taking a knuckle curve for a strike to start the at-bat, Megill doubled up on the pitch and Arcia crushed a 386-foot solo shot to left center that tied the game at 2-2. That would be Arcia’s only hit in four at-bats on the day. For the season, the 30-year-old infielder is slashing just .196/.228/.299 with two homers and six RBI, so this will be a season highlight for him for sure.
